+# This test is a modified version of agskip test written by Alain Renaud.
+#
+#   Phase 1: Create an xfs filesystem with AGCOUNT=32 and verify that the
+#            AGCOUNT is 32.
+#   Phase 2: Mount the filesystem with AGSKIP=3.
+#   Phase 3: Verify that the AGSKIP is working correctly:
+#            Create a file that spans more than one AG (size=1.5 * AGSIZE)
+#            Create another file that is less than AGSIZE.
+#            Use xfs_bmap to verify that the second extent is at location
+#            previous_AG+1.
+#            Continue creating/verifying that the AG's are created 3 AG's
+#            apart
+#

+BLK_SIZE=4096
+AGCOUNT=32
+AGSKIP=3
+
+# Modify as appropriate.
+_supported_fs xfs
+_supported_os Linux
+
+echo "Phase 1: mkfs the filesystem" >> $seq.full 2>&1
+echo "DEBUG: agcount=${AGCOUNT}" >> $seq.full 2>&1
+_scratch_mkfs_xfs " -dagcount=${AGCOUNT}" \
+    >> $seq.full 2>&1 || _fail "mkfs_xfs failed"
+
+# Get fs agcount
+_agcount=$( xfs_db -r -c 'sb 0' -c 'print' ${SCRATCH_DEV} | \
+    awk '$1 == "agcount" { print $3 }' ) >> $seq.full 2>&1
+_agblocks=$( xfs_db -r -c 'sb 0' -c 'print' ${SCRATCH_DEV} | \
+    awk '$1 == "agblocks" { print $3 }' ) >> $seq.full 2>&1
+
+# Print size in meg
+_agsize=$(( _agblocks * ${BLK_SIZE} / 1024 / 1024 )) >> $seq.full 2>&1
+
+if [[ "${_agcount}" -ne ${AGCOUNT} ]]
+then
+    echo "ERROR: agcount(${_agcount}) value is incorrect " >> $seq.full 2>&1
+    exit
+fi
+
+echo "Phase 2: mount filesystem with agskip option" >> $seq.full 2>&1
+echo "DEBUG: agskip=${AGSKIP} "  >> $seq.full 2>&1
+
+# mount
+_scratch_mount "-o agskip=${AGSKIP}" >> $seq.full 2>&1 \
+    || _fail "xfs_mount failed"
+
+echo "Phase 3: test agskip option"
+mkdir ${SCRATCH_MNT}/agskip-${AGSKIP}.dir >> $seq.full 2>&1 \
+    || _fail "mkdir failed"
+
+# make the first file with 2 extents
+FSIZE=$(( ${_agsize} + (  ${_agsize} / 2 )))
+FILE=${SCRATCH_MNT}/agskip-${AGSKIP}.dir/file-0
+echo "DEBUG: making first file with size = ${FSIZE}m" >> $seq.full 2>&1
+xfs_mkfile ${FSIZE}m ${FILE} >> $seq.full 2>&1 \
+    || _fail "failed to make file ${FILE}"
+
+agvalue=$( xfs_bmap -v ${FILE} | awk '$1 == "0:" { print $4 }')
+
+# make sure that the second extent is at location AG+1
+_agtmp=$( xfs_bmap -v ${FILE} | awk '$1 == "1:" { print $4 }')
+
+if [[ $(( ( agvalue + 1 ) % AGCOUNT )) -ne ${_agtmp} ]]
+then
+    echo -n "ERROR: The AG location of extent-1=${_agtmp}" >> $seq.full 2>&1
+    echo    "       as where extent-0=${agvalue}" >> $seq.full 2>&1
+    exit
+fi
+
+_cmpt=1
+while [[ ${_cmpt} -lt 25 ]]
+do
+    FILE=${SCRATCH_MNT}/agskip-${AGSKIP}.dir/file-${_cmpt}
+    if ! xfs_mkfile 10m ${FILE}
+    then
+        echo "ERROR: failed to make file ${FILE}" >> $seq.full 2>&1
+        exit
+    fi
+    _agtmp=$( xfs_bmap -v ${FILE} | awk '$1 == "0:" { print $4 }')
+    if [[ $(( ( agvalue + AGSKIP ) % AGCOUNT )) -ne ${_agtmp} ]]
+    then
+        echo "ERROR: The AG location of file ${FILE} not at AG+${AGSKIP}" \
+             >> $seq.full 2>&1
+        echo "       old AG == ${agvalue} new AG == ${_agtmp}" >> $seq.full 2>&1
+        exit
+    fi
+    agvalue=${_agtmp}
+    let _cmpt++
+done
+
+echo "# unmounting scratch" >> $seq.full 2>&1
+${UMOUNT_PROG} ${SCRATCH_MNT} >>$seq.full 2>&1 || _fail "unmount failed"
+
+# success, all done
+status=0
+_cleanup
+exit
